**Vendor note: Inkmill markdown pipeline**

Rendering for Parchway docs is outsourced to Inkmill under an annual contract, renewing each March. They handle sanitization and PDF export; we own the upload queue. SLA: 4-hour response on rendering failures. Escalate only after two failed retries. Their support desk is reachable at the address below.

billing contact of hahaf-baguf = zorael.tammir.jorius@sivrelhq.internal

- [ ] **Step 7: Breaker override escrow.** After sealing the signing keys for the Tallgrove upstream API circuit breaker, confirm the support team can force the breaker open during a full outage. The override bundle lives in the sealed escrow drawer and is useless without its unlock phrase. Two ceremony witnesses must initial this step before proceeding. The escrow bundle is decrypted with the recovery passphrase that follows.

vault phrase of kahip-kahop = holath-quenmir

## Tuning

Vramscope's sampler trades overhead for resolution, and the defaults lean conservative because nobody wants the profiler itself eating GPU headroom during an incident. If you're on-call and chasing a leak, it's usually fine to crank the sample rate for a few minutes — just remember to dial it back, since the ring buffer fills fast and old allocations get evicted silently. Snapshot compression helps on long captures but costs a core. The knobs you'll actually touch live in one place, reproduced here.

limits module of fajog-tawig:
RATE_LIMITS = {
    "druwyn": 2,
    "quenael": 10,
    "wenix": 2,
    "druael": 2,
}